3M Ushers in a New Era of Non-Metallic Foil

Company to Introduce New Technology for Financial Transaction Cards That Offer Functionality with Style at Cartes 2009.

St. Paul, Minn.—3M Display and Graphics today unveiled new 3M Non-metallic Foil technology that can transform financial transaction cards, such as credit, ATM and gift cards, as we know them. Specifically, by utilizing proprietary 3M Multi-layer Optical Film, the company makes it possible to create stylish financial transaction cards that contain no metal and can be uniquely designed with custom colors, graphics and logos to meet customers’ needs, while maintaining functionality. The company plans to debut its Non-metallic Foil technology at Cartes 2009 in Paris, France, to financial transaction companies and credit card manufacturers as part of 3M’s new Payment Component Business.

Building upon more than seven decades of expertise in optical science, 3M’s Multi-layer Optical Film is composed of hundreds of layers, combining the company’s core technologies—film, adhesives and light management. 3M’s one-of-a-kind Light Management technology was discovered in the 1990s while 3M scientists were researching improvements to increase tape durability. The team realized that they could create films with unique optical properties by combining layers with different refractive qualities—creating a non-metallic, mirror-like film that can be more than 90 percent reflective. 3M’s core Light Management technology emulates what nature has already perfected by reflecting light to create vivid colors without pigment that can be seen in butterfly wings, cat’s eyes and abalone. The technology can be used for a host of diverse applications, ranging from electronic devices displays to decorative products to energy-saving security window films.

3M Non-Metallic Foil Technology - Using revolutionary Light Management technology, 3M’s new Non-Metallic Foil gives transaction cards a mirror-like finish to create snazzy, colorful credit cards. This advanced technology is safe to use in contactless cards and offers full ATM functionality. Cards can change colors at an angle based on the background color and are also translucent when coupled with 3M’s IR blocking technology.

3M Clear IR Technology - In addition, 3M’s offers Clear Infrared (IR) technology—a proprietary film that blocks infrared light. An IR light-blocking material is laminated between two layers of PVC and covers the entire card —allowing light to transmit through the card. This novel, see-through card and flexible production process opens the door for customers to create unique transparent designs and take advantage of modern printing techniques. Moreover, the innovative IR blocking technology prevents cards from jamming in ATMs.
